Hi, I have a 77 trans am with a 71 455 with 98 heads and ram air 3 manifolds an edelbrock performer 750 cfm carb what i believe to be a Stock cam and edelbrock rpm intake and 29 inch tires in the rear with 3.42 gears can someone tell me if i would get a bigger upgrade from a camshaft or from #96 heads and also if anyone could give me a current hp/tq estimate and perhaps an estimate of what it would be with a crower 60243 and what it would be with the heads and perhaps with both as well?? (also quarter mile estimates never hurt either) Very Happy

I would find 6X4 or 6X8 heads and the Crower 60243 or 60919. Some port work to the heads 7/16th BBC screw in rocker studs. roller rockers with poly locks headers good bottom end should be around 450 hp iron intake and qjet carb from 76-79.

No.98 heads have 1.96/1.66 valves, 114cc chambers, and press-in studs- not my choice for a 400+ hp 455 build. No.96 heads are a much better choice- 2.11/1.77 valves, 96cc chambers, and screw-in studs will yield around 9-9.2:1 SCR on a 455. I've ran a Crower 60243 in a 455 with 6x-4's, stock intake and Q-jet- the combo broke into the 12's w/ a TH-400, 2500 stall, and 3.23 posi, so it's safe to say that engine was making at least 425+ hp.

The stock 225/70R15's (2nd gen T/A) are bout 27" tall- a 29" tall tire will slow your Bird down and reduce your gearing to an 3.18:1 effective ratio.
